OFFLINE STEPS:
STEP 1 Discuss the divorce with your spouse and verbally agree on issues concerning the children, division of the estate etc.
STEP 2 Sign the Deed of Settlement (we will provide) and have your spouse sign it as well.
STEP 3 Take the documents to your court where the registrar of the court will allocate a case number. Then take the documents to your local Sheriff to deliver to your spouse. (It would speed up the process if your spouse can go with you to the sheriff's office).
STEP 4 If there are minor children involved, you will also have to send the Deed of Settlement to the Family Advocate's office for endorsement). 10 Days after your spouse has received the documents from the sheriff, you will get a court date.
STEP 5 Appear in court on this date and your divorce will be finalized.
